Which BEST describes a result of the Supreme Court's decision in the Dred Scott case?
Lyrx [107]

The correct answer is C) A slave was not a citizen but rather the property of an owner.

The Dred Scott vs. Sandford case revolved around the claims of Dred Scott, a black man who was a slave. This man argued that he should be free, as his owner brought him into the Illnois territory were slavery was prohibited. Essentially, Scott argued that his living in this territory should make him free.

However, the Supreme Court ruled against Scott. The majority opinion discussed how slaves are property and that they have no rights in which white men need to respect. This controversial case caused a huge division in American society.
